Smoke Condition Evacuates Catholic Charities
Building has been deemed safe for re-entry, but currently has no fire protection.
Catholic Charities, on Route 22, was evacuated Wednesday after a fire alarm went off, and a report was made of smoke in the mechanical room, according to North Branch Volunteer Fire Chief Dave Hickson. Hickson said the building manager of Catholic Charities told him that he had gone into the mechanical room to check the fire panel after the smoke alarm went off around 12:30 p.m. Wednesday, and saw smoke coming from the panel. "Our standard procedure for smoke in a building is a full first alarm assignment, which brings us Green Knoll and Country Hills Fire for a full response along with Bradley Gardens Fire for their specialized Rapid Intervention Team," Hickson said.
